The market of note is for the men's Money in the Bank ladder match.
The most recent change - from last night - saw Solo Sikoa's price continue a decline that had started on Wednesday when he dipped from +1,400 into +1,200. By last night, the Solo Sikoa selection had reached +700.
I surmise one of the reasons why the descent occurred yesterday is because there was a report circulating on social media which suggested that Seth Rollins and Solo Sikoa were two names being considered the most.
For what it's worth, Sikoa is the equivalent of +500 in markets that are domestic to me. Those are the same odds you could have found him earlier this week.
The very same report hedged that Naomi and Rhea Ripley were the top of the potential winners list for the women's match. As you can see, Naomi has been BetOnline's favourite since the market was published. At one point her price drifted, but it moved in from -150 into -155 overnight.
Ripley had been the early second-favourite, but has since lost that spot to Stephanie Vaquer who has plummeted from +1,000 into +300 as this week has unfolded.
Another selection with shorter odds than earlier this week is Roxanne Perez. She is currently +500 but was +700 when I came across the market shortly after it went live on Tuesday.
The Women's Intercontinental Championship match market initially had Becky Lynch drop from -250 into -2,000 to win her challenge against Lyra Valkyria. Since then, however, the champ has been backed from +700 into +300.
